My mom is my role model. It took me 23 years to realize that, but it's definitely the truth. Right now, she's fighting for her life (literally) and that has made me realize that she is, in fact, my role model. My mom is dying of stage IV kidney cancer. On the outside, it doesn't look like she's sick at all. She has a ton of energy and still tries to run the house. But, despite that, she's incredibly sick.

Aside from that, my mom's sheer amount of strength and stubbornness is what makes me idolize her. That, and her integrity. She's the strongest person I've ever met. All throughout her illness, she's had a positive outlook and continues to fight even though the doctors have told her that her cancer is not curable. They can prolong her life but, ultimately, the cancer will kill her.

She's also incredibly nice. She's the sort of person that will do anything for anyone. She once got up at 2:00am to go out with me to look for a friend of mine who had been kicked out of her home. My mom had to get up a couple hours later to go to work. She never once gave it a second thought. She wanted to find my friend and make sure she had someplace safe to stay. She's also done a lot for my boyfriend. She bought him an entirely new wardrobe and a new pair of glasses because he didn't have any money. My boyfriend spent most of his childhood living on the streets with his family. He didn't have a stable household, really, until he was in his teens. When we met, he only had one or two shirts and a pair of shorts to his name. Now, almost two years later, he has an entire wardrobe of clothes, shoes, and a pair of glasses that actually help him see much better all thanks to my mom.

My mom is a completely selfless woman. She definitely puts others before herself.
